Manager/Sr. Manager Drug Safety Operations
Stamford, Connecticut  
Return to Search Results | Send job to a friend
  Description: 
Description: Position supports the Director in leading the Drug Safety Operations function. Manages assigned staff in performing Case Management responsibilities. Contributes innovative ideas and implementation plans for further development and improvement of drug safety processes.
Mgr/Sr Mgr. will manage and supervise assigned staff and Operations processes, including resource planning, recruiting, and performance management; training and development; work prioritization, resource allocation and delegation; and issue resolution / escalation. They perform single case review of case for medical content & accuracy, as assigned and assist with surveillance activities including review of case series & frequency reports. They will oversee Workflow Management; use daily compliance reports to monitor and prioritize work for the Case Management function. They will propose and lead improvement initiatives as assigned. The individual will ensure compliance with relevant policies and procedures; review group performance metrics, identifying issues, analyzing root causes, and defining improvement plans. They will assist the Director in establishing goals in line with department strategies and monitoring progress against them.
  Educational Requirements: Manager:
RN, BSN, Nurse Practitioner, Pharmacist, Physician Assistant or related bachelor-level degree required.

Senior Manager:
RN, BSN, Nurse Practitioner, Pharmacist, Physician Assistant or related bachelor-level degree required.   Required Experience & Technical Requirements Manager:
- Minimum 6 years of experience in a pharmaceutical company or clinical environment
- Minimum 4 years of Drug Safety experience required
- At least 1 year Managerial experience in a Drug Safety environment with Personnel management, including recruiting, coaching and training, evaluating performance, providing feedback, development planning strongly preferred

Senior Manager:
- Minimum 7 years of experience in a pharmaceutical company or clinical environment
- Minimum 5 years of Drug Safety experience required
- Minimum 3 yr managerial experience required,  Drug Safety environment strongly preferred

For both levels:
- Advanced understanding of FDA and international regulations
- Advanced understanding of company's processes (including relevant SOPs, WPDs), documentation, requirements, and organization
- Product knowledge (labeling, therapeutic class)
- Data entry and computer skills
- Advanced skills with Argus and basic MS Office applications, and eDocs; basic understanding of RADocs, GRASP
- Working knowledge of scientific terms and medical terminology
- Working knowledge of MedDRA
- Written and verbal communication skills; interpersonal skills
- Organization skills; analytical thinking
- Time management and ability to prioritize workload (self and others)
- Quality orientation:  attention to detail, accuracy
- Meeting facilitation
- Working knowledge of Project Management
- Advanced understanding of safety processes
- Ability to apply Drug Safety / Clinical experience in AE assessment
- Advanced understanding of documentation requirements in a regulated environment
- Ability to influence others
- Understanding of training concepts
